Japanese antique treasure map

Ancient Kyoto may be the best place for treasure hunting and antique shopping for those who love old items. In the traditional neighborhoods, you can find antique shops or prop shops every few steps. And during holidays, lively antique markets are held in major temples, shrines, and parks.

East temple "hongfa city" antique market

"Hofo Market" will gather nearly 1000 shops, including about 150 antique shops. It can be said that it is one of the best choices to experience Kyoto's traditional market culture.

Beiye tianmangong "tianshen city" antique market

"Tenjin Flea Market" is a very suitable leisure market to spend time, besides a series of interesting booths such as antiques, bonsai, Tenjin's vintage clothing is very famous. Every month, there are many foreign tourists participating in Tenjin Flea Market, selecting and purchasing beautiful vintage kimonos and fabrics at very reasonable prices.

Feng the shrine "ガ ラ ク タ city" antique market

The Fugan Shrine near Sanjusangendo in Kyoto is a place that hosts three markets every month. The traditional market, mainly selling antiques and vintage clothing, is held on the 8th of every month.

Mei lu park craft fair

Meikojicho Park Handmade Market takes place on the first Saturday of each month from 9:00 to 16:00, attracting crowds of people who come to shop in the park.

Pinganle handmade market

"Located in the Okazaki Park, Heian Rakusan Handmade Market is held on the 2nd Saturday of every month from 10:00 to 16:00. Here you can find a variety of handmade goods, including popular toys."

Upper hemao shrine craft market

Located at the Handmade Market of Kamigamo Shrine, the market is open on the 4th Sunday of every month from 9:00 am to 4:00 pm. Many antique items can be found here.

Beishan handmade courtyard

Located in Kitayama Craft Garden's handmade market, every first Sunday of the month from 10:00 to 16:00 is the appointed time for you. Handmade items are a major feature here.
